How we rate this daycareCalifornia CCLD records›
California pre-grades every violation itself: Type A means an immediate risk to a child's health, safety, or personal rights; Type B means a violation that, if not corrected, could become that same immediate risk. We never escalate above the state's own grade.
🔴 Serious concerns — any of:
- The license is on probation — CCLD requires the facility to comply with specific terms and conditions to prevent revocation of its license
- A Type A violation is on record — CCLD's own most serious grade, meaning an immediate risk to a child's health, safety, or personal rights
🟡 Watch carefully — any of:
- A Type B violation is on record — CCLD's own lesser-risk grade, meaning a violation that, if not corrected, could become an immediate risk to a child's health, safety, or personal rights
🟢 Clean
Actively licensed, with no violations in your lookback window.
Worth knowing: California's public records don't always say whether a specific violation was later fixed, so we don't discount a Type A's severity by guessing at correction status — CCLD's own definition notes a Type A citation "will always be issued, even if the violation is corrected on the spot." A single Type A moves a facility to Serious concerns, matching CCLD's own grading directly.
